Read MoreNo system is secure at the operating system level. The safest and most secure systems start with open secure silicon and provide assurances upon that highly secure foundation below the operating system.
Built on the OpenTitan open-source silicon root of trust (RoT) project, zeroRISC delivers transparency and trustworthiness for data centers and ICS/OT, IoT and edge devices.
The zeroRISC platform is the only all-in-one drop-in silicon, software and services solution that delivers trustworthy, cloud-based secure device management below the operating system, while making secure ownership transfer straightforward.
The Silicon RoT ensures that the hardware infrastructure and the software that runs on it remain in the intended, trustworthy state by verifying that the critical system components boot securely using only authorized and verifiable code.
The zeroRISC team is comprised of key members of the original OpenTitan project — the world’s first open-source digital design for silicon RoTs to include commercial-grade design verification, top-level testing, and continuous integration (CI).
As leaders in the project, zeroRISC played a critical role in completing the first discrete silicon tapeout and is driving efforts to validate that first chip and bring it to commercial production.
